The root directory of your website is the content that loads when visitors access your domain name in a Web browser. The most obvious consequence of this is that you need to put your "index file" in your website's root directory for visitors to see your site at all.
Website-related applications might also need to know your website's root directory.
The document root is the folder where the website files for a domain name are stored. Since cPanel allows for multiple domain names (addon domains and subdomains), you need to have a unique folder for each domain.
The document root is a directory (a folder) that is stored on your host's servers and that is designated for holding web pages. When someone else looks at your web site, this is the location they will be accessing.

The web root directory of an app is the directory that files are served from.
When talking about a web server, the web root is the topmost (or “highest”) directory on that web server where the files are served from.
The root directory, or root folder, is the top-level directory of a file system. The directory structure can be visually represented as an upside-down tree, so the term "root" represents the top level.
A domain's document root, also known as the home folder, is the main folder that contains all of the files for either a domain or a subdomain. Main Domain. The document root for your main domain name is your public_html folder.
